Flyash & Bottom ash Conveying Systems

The flushing equipment serves to mix the ash with the water and discharge the ash in the form of slurry. The Dry fly ash system consists of a two stage ESP and duct hopper ash removal conveying system. The first stage includes extraction of dry fly ash from under the various ESP / duct hoppers to intermediate hoppers located near the ESPs.

Fly ash conveying

Fly ash can also be conveyed in different ways. It can be transported using either pressure (positive) conveying or vacuum (negative) conveying.The former uses compressed air at the start of the system to push the ash through the piping while it is "sucked" toward its destination when using the latter.

Cyclone as a precleaner to ESP--a need for Indian coal based thermal

It is proposed that a cyclone be used, as a pre-cleaner to ESP so that the large size fraction of fly-ash can be removed in the pre-cleaning and the remaining flue-gas entering the ESP will then contain only small size particles with low dust loading, thereby requiring a small ESP, and improving overall efficiency of dust removal.

Electrostatic beneficiation of fly ash

Fly ash particles are very fine compared to other minerals that are separated by electrostatics. Measured by dry ultrasonic sieving, fly ash from pulverized coal-fired boilers typically has only 10%–30% of the mass > 325 mesh (+ 45 μm).The median particle diameter is typically 15–20 μm.The median size of the unburned carbon particles is generally larger than …

Cyclone separator

Cyclone separators or simply cyclones are separation devices (dry scrubbers) that use the principle of inertia to remove particulate matter from flue gases. Cyclone separators is one of many air pollution control devices known as precleaners since they generally remove larger pieces of particulate matter. Fly Ash Separation Technologies

The first step in the separation process involves screening the fly ash to remove oversized particles and debris. This is typically accomplished using vibrating screens or air classifiers, which separate the fly ash into different size fractions based on particle size distribution. 4. Magnetic Separation
